WebJun 11, 2024 · The Triple Bottom Line, or TBL, is an economic concept. This concept came into existence due to increasing awareness of social and environmental issues. This concept suggests that a company and its business have to sustain themselves for a longer time. Hence, the firm should not just be guided by the idea of profit maximization. In traditional accounting, there is a single “bottom line,” an economic or financial one. Triple Bottom Line accounting broadens the scope of accounting to include social and environmental impacts as well. The triple bottom line is defined as having three components: People, Planet, and Profit. These represent the societal, environmental, and financial impact of business decisions.
